The “Juice” singer stepped out for music’s biggest night with boyfriend Myke Wright wearing a show-shopping, voluminous Dolce & Gabbana look. Her fiery orange gown was beautiful on its own, but the singer topped the dress with a flower-covered hooded cape in a matching tone.
She wore chunky rings on her fingers and even matched her eye makeup to her gown, opting for a soft orange hue on her lids. She wore her hair in soft curls and tucked a flower behind her ear, evoking thesoftness of spring— she even captioned her Instagram of her look with “Spring awakening.”

Lizzo, 34, wasnominated for five awardsat this year’s show. She earned nominations for record of the year for “About Damn Time” — which she won — album of the year forSpecial, song of the year for “About Damn Time,” best pop vocal album forSpecialand best pop solo performance for “About Damn Time.”

Lizzo’s albumSpecialwas released last July and peaked at No. 2 on the Billboard 200 chart last year. This album is the home of Lizzo’s “About Damn Time,” which has gone twice platinum in the U.S. and went totally viral on TikTok.

Aside from shutting down a stage with her music, Lizzo also knows how to shut down a red carpet with her sartorial choices. Though she didn’t attend last year’s show, she did show up in 2021 wearing two candy-colored dresses. Both of her Balmain looks appeared to be sister dresses, with their ruched detailing and ruffled hems. The green dress she stepped onto the carpet wearing was short and flirty, while the pink dress she switched into had a longer hem.
The year before, she went forOld Hollywood glamour in an all-white look.
The singer wore a strapless white Versace gown with sweetheart-style neckline, featuring sparkly silver beading throughout. She teamed the look with an elegant white feathery stole and white crystal-adorned strappy heels, plus $2 million worth of Lorraine Schwartz jewelry including a double strand diamond necklace, custom diamond earrings and diamond rings.
